Cự Khê
Definition
- Proper Noun:
- A commune name: "Cự Khê" is the name of a specific commune (xã) located within Thanh Oai District, Hà Tây Province, Vietnam. It is a geographical proper noun used to identify this administrative division.

Variants and Related Words
- Xã Cự Khê: The full administrative title, meaning "Cự Khê Commune".
- Huyện Thanh Oai: Thanh Oai District, the larger administrative unit containing Cự Khê.
- Tỉnh Hà Tây: Hà Tây Province, the former provincial unit (note: Hà Tây province was merged into Hanoi in 2008).

Note on Usage
- "Cự Khê" is solely a place name. The individual characters "Cự" and "Khê" may have separate meanings (e.g., "cự" can mean huge, "khê" can mean stream), but when combined, they form a fixed proper noun with no other general meaning in modern usage.
